Drone Surveillance Market size was valued at USD 205.6 million in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 249.8 million in 2024 to USD 1186.34 million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 21.5%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
The drone surveillance market has experienced remarkable growth in recent years, driven by the increasing demand for advanced and efficient security and monitoring solutions. Drones, or un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s), equipped with cameras and sensors, provide real-time surveillance and monitoring capabilities across various sectors. The market growth is propelled by the rising need for enhanced border security, disaster management, infrastructure inspection, law enforcement, and industrial monitoring.
One of the significant drivers of the drone surveillance market is the technological advancements in UAVs, including improved battery life, enhanced communication systems, and high-resolution imaging capabilities. These advancements have expanded the applications of drones in various sectors, contributing to their increasing adoption. Additionally, the growing adoption of drone-as-a-service (DaaS) models and the integration of AI and machine learning technologies further boost the market's growth.
The military and defense sector plays a crucial role in the growth of the drone surveillance market, utilizing drones for surveillance, reconnaissance, and intelligence gathering purposes. Furthermore, industries like agriculture, energy, and construction are increasingly adopting drone surveillance for efficient monitoring of large areas, assets, and infrastructure.
Geographically, North America leads the drone surveillance market due to substantial investments in defense and security sectors, along with a favorable regulatory environment. The Asia Pacific region is also witnessing significant growth, driven by the increasing adoption of drones for surveillance purposes across industries and government initiatives promoting drone technology.
As the drone surveillance market continues to evolve, advancements in technology, regulatory developments, and the expansion of use cases are expected to shape its growth trajectory, offering innovative solutions for various surveillance and monitoring challenges.

Rapid technological advancements in drone capabilities, such as longer flight times, improved imaging systems, and enhanced data analytics, are driving the growth of the drone surveillance market. These advancements allow for more efficient and accurate monitoring and inspection of energy and power facilities.
Rise in Adoption of Multirotor Drones: The use of multirotor drones, known for their stability and maneuverability, is on the rise. These drones are extensively employed for pipeline monitoring, offshore platform inspection, wind turbine inspection, and other applications in the energy and power sector due to their versatility and ease of use.
